Hi. Awesome plugin.

I am giving a user the ability to edit one page, and create sub-pages. I have a plugin for PAGES that "Eclude Pages" from being in the user menus (usually at the top of the blog).

The one page this user is able to edit is a TOP page in terms of hierarchy. I want that page to NOT be excluded from the user menus, but I want all the other sub-pages the user might create to all be excluded.

I would like to prevent the user to edit the Exclude Page settings for any pages. And I want to set the Exclude Page settings for all new sub-pages the user would be creating to OFF (as "do not include the page in the user menus).

Is that possible?
